Common Misconception #1: Braces Are Only for Kids and Teens


What's Actually True: Orthodontic treatment is effective for patients of all ages.

Braces and Invisalign are both excellent treatment options for adults as well as children and teens. Many adults choose to begin orthodontic treatment later in life to improve both the function and appearance of their smile. With modern orthodontic options, straightening teeth as an adult is more comfortable and accessible than ever.


Common Misconception #2: Braces Are Only Cosmetic


What's Actually True:  Straight teeth support both appearance and oral health.

While a straighter smile can improve confidence, orthodontic treatment also plays an important role in long-term dental health. Properly aligned teeth are easier to clean, which helps reduce the risk of:

  • Cavities

  • Gum disease

  • Tooth decay

  • Uneven wear on teeth

A properly aligned bite can also support better jaw function and overall oral comfort.



Common Misconception #3: Braces Are Painful Throughout Treatment


What’s Actually True: Any discomfort is temporary and typically mild.

It is normal to experience slight soreness after braces are first placed or adjusted. However, this usually only lasts a few days. Modern orthodontic technology is designed to move teeth more gently and efficiently.


Common Misconception #4: You Can’t Eat Your Favorite Foods with Braces


What’s Actually True: Most foods are still enjoyable with a few simple adjustments.

Patients with braces are advised to avoid very sticky, hard, or chewy foods that may damage brackets or wires. However, there are still many braces-friendly options, including:

  • Pasta

  • Yogurt

  • Smoothies

  • Soft fruits

  • Cooked vegetables


With a extra care, patients can continue enjoying a wide variety of foods during treatment.


Common Misconception #5: Braces Take a Very Long Time to Work


What’s Actually True: Treatment time varies, but many patients see results within a predictable timeframe.


Orthodontic treatment length depends on each individual case. However, many patients complete treatment within a planned and structured timeline. Staying consistent with appointments and following care instructions helps ensure the best possible outcome.


Why Straight Teeth Matter for Your Health


Straight teeth are about more than appearance, they are an important part of overall oral health.


Crowded or misaligned teeth can make brushing and flossing more difficult, which may increase the risk of plaque buildup and gum issues. Proper alignment helps improve daily oral hygiene and supports long-term dental health.
